Ejemplo n.º 1
0
 public function ajaxOrderLogs($request, $response)
 {/*{{{*/
     $response->orderLogList = array();
     $orderId = $request->orderid;
     if(false == empty($orderId))
     {
         $options['orderId'] = $orderId;
         $groupNameList = TelOrderTask::getGroupName($response->curInspector);
         $response->orderLogList = DAL::get()->find_all_by_groupName_and_Options('TelOrderRemark', $groupNameList, $limit = 50, $options);
     }
 }/*}}}*/
 public function ajaxTelOrderTaskRemarks($request, $response)
 {/*{{{*/
     $taskId = trim($request->taskId);
     DBC::requireNotEmptyString($taskId, 'taskId空了');
     $telOrderTask = DAL::get()->find('TelOrderTask',$taskId);
     DBC::requireFalse($telOrderTask->isNull(), '找不到预约任务');
     $options['taskId'] = $taskId;
     $groupNameList = TelOrderTask::getGroupName($response->curInspector);
     $response->taskRemarkListList = DAL::get()->find_all_by_groupName_and_Options('TelOrderRemark', $groupNameList, 10, $options);
 }/*}}}*/
 public function telTaskList4AfterSaler($request, $response)
 {
     /*{{{*/
     $page = $request->page ? $request->page : 1;
     $response->page = $page;
     $pageSize = 20;
     $response->pageSize = $pageSize;
     $taskStatus = $request->taskStatus || $request->taskStatus == 0 ? $request->taskStatus : TelOrderTask::transStatusOrTypeArray2String(TelOrderTask::$taskStatusDesc);
     $taskType = $request->taskType ? $request->taskType : TelOrderTask::transStatusOrTypeArray2String(TelOrderTask::$telTaskType4AfterSaler);
     $params = array('taskStatus' => $taskStatus, 'exeUserName' => $request->exeUserName, 'telNo' => $request->telNo, 'inComingCallTel' => $request->inComingCallTel, 'callBackTel' => $request->callBackTel, 'taskType' => $taskType, 'searchBeginTime' => $request->searchBeginTime, 'searchEndTime' => $request->searchEndTime);
     $res = TelOrderTaskClient::getInstance()->getTelTaskList($page, $pageSize, $params);
     $telTaskList = $res['tasklist'];
     $response->telTaskList = $telTaskList;
     $response->params = $params;
     $response->taskStatus = $request->taskStatus;
     $response->taskType = $request->taskType;
     if (false == empty($res['pageInfo'])) {
         $response->total = $res['pageInfo']['total'];
         $response->pageLink = PageNav::getNavLink(PageNav::getPageNavTemplate("teltasklist4aftersaler?taskStatus={$request->taskStatus}&telNo={$request->telNo}&inComingCallTel={$request->inComingCallTel}&callBackTek={$request->callBackTel}&taskType={$request->taskType}&exeUserName={$request->exeUserName}&searchBeginTime={$request->searchBeginTime}&searchEndTime={$request->searchEndTime}&page="), $res['pageInfo']['nowpage'], $res['pageInfo']['pagesize'], $res['pageInfo']['total']);
     }
 }
Ejemplo n.º 4
0
                    有患者<?=$userName?>任务
                   </span> </a> </br>
                </td>
            </tr>
                <?}} ?>
                <?} else { ?>
                <?php  if(isset($taskCount) && (false == empty($taskCount))) {  
                    $j = 0 ;
                foreach($spaceList as $space){
                    $j ++;
                ?>
                <tr style=<?= (($j)%2 == 1)?" background:#FFCCFF;" : ""?> >
            <td  >
            <a href="http://<?=URL_PREFIX?>hdfadmin.haodf.com/paymentfront/telordertask/taskdetail?spaceId=<?=$space->id?>&taskStatus=<?=$taskStatus?>&patientName=<?=$userName?>&orderId=<?=$orderId?>&patientPhone=<?=$userPhone?>&timeType=<?=$timeType?>&searchBeginTime=<?=$searchBeginTime?>&searchEndTime=<?=$searchEndTime?>&rand=<?=rand()?>" target="content_frm" class="list"  >
                    <span>
               <b style="background:<?=TelOrderTask::returnDisplayBgColorByPriority($taskCount[$space->id]['priority'])?>"   >  &nbsp;   <?= $offset+$j ?> &nbsp;   </b>
                    <?=$space->host->hospitalfaculty->hospital->name ?>&nbsp; &nbsp;
                    <?=$space->host->hospitalfaculty->name?> &nbsp;&nbsp;&nbsp;
                    <?=$space->name?> &nbsp;&nbsp;&nbsp;
                    <? foreach($taskCount as $key=>$value){
                        if($space->id == $key){
                    ?>
                    任务(<?=$value['countid']?>)
                   </span> </a> </br>
                </td>
            </tr>
                <?} } } }} ?>
        </table>
                <?=$pagelink?>
</div>
<div class="clearfix mt20 ml40">